Jogging around Antime, Portugal, offers a variety of routes through its diverse landscape. The region features a mix of rolling hills, river valleys, and forested areas, providing varied terrain for runners. Elevation changes are common, with some routes including significant climbs. The trails often lead through natural settings, showcasing the local topography.

While most routes are moderate to difficult, there is at least one easy running route available. For a more accessible option with less elevation, consider the Praia Fluvial de Docim loop from São Gens, which is a moderate 5.6 miles (9.0 km) path often following riverine landscapes.
Yes, many of the running routes around Antime are circular. Examples include the challenging Eucalipto – Mamoa loop from Infesta, the moderate Praia Fluvial de Docim loop from São Gens, and the longer Albufeira de Queimadela – Morgair loop from Revelhe.
Many routes in Antime lead through natural settings, showcasing the local topography of rolling hills and river valleys. For instance, the Praia Fluvial de Docim loop from São Gens often follows riverine landscapes, providing pleasant views.
While jogging, you'll be in proximity to several historical and cultural landmarks. Nearby attractions include the impressive Palace of the Dukes of Braganza, the historic Guimarães Castle Park, and the charming Oliveira Square in Guimarães. These offer opportunities to explore the region's rich heritage.
Yes, Antime offers several challenging routes. The Eucalipto – Mamoa loop from Infesta is a difficult 9.3 miles (15.0 km) trail with notable elevation gain through wooded areas. Another demanding option is the Albufeira de Queimadela – Morgair loop from Revelhe, a 16.2 miles (26.1 km) trail with significant ascents.
The longest running route listed is the Alto da Penícia loop from Rego, which spans 31.7 km (19.7 miles) and involves substantial elevation gain, making it a difficult and extended run.
Yes, the region features river valleys. The Praia Fluvial de Docim loop from São Gens is a moderate path that often follows riverine landscapes, providing a refreshing experience alongside water.
